Minnesota Online Betting At-a-glance
As of 2026, Minnesota sports betting is still prohibited at a state level, despite ongoing legislative attempts to introduce legal frameworks. This contrasts with neighboring states like Iowa, which legalized both online and retail sports betting as early as 2019. Interest in legalized betting continues to grow, with significant economic implications due to Minnesotans placing bets in surrounding jurisdictions. Unfortunately, several bills, such as Senate Bill 757, failed to pass the legislature this year.
In Minnesota, major professional sports teams like the Vikings and Twins attract substantial fan engagement, yet locals resort to neighboring states to place legal bets. The state’s metro area hosts a full array of big league teams, making it a prime candidate for legalized sports betting markets when legislation finally gets the green light.
The journey toward legal sports betting in Minnesota involves balancing interests among tribal nations and legislators. Discussions are slated to continue potentially into 2026, focusing on creating opportunities that will extend both retail and mobile betting options statewide.
Offshore Sports Betting: a Legal Grey Area
Sports betting comes in several forms, and it helps to know the difference. Regulated sportsbooks, offshore sportsbooks, and daily fantasy sports (DFS) platforms each offer distinct experiences for bettors.
- Regulated sportsbooks are licensed and overseen by local or state authorities, ensuring consumer protections, secure transactions, and adherence to legal standards.
- Offshore sportsbooks, on the other hand, operate outside U.S. jurisdiction, often offering broader markets and bonuses, but without the same legal safeguards or recourse if issues arise.
- Daily fantasy sports platforms like DraftKings and FanDuel fall into a separate category, focusing on player performance-based contests rather than traditional betting lines, and are legal in most U.S. states under different regulatory frameworks.

Popular Betting Markets
Even without legal sportsbooks in Minnesota, fans follow the same betting interests you’d see nationwide. The NFL and NBA always lead the way, with the Vikings and Timberwolves drawing plenty of attention. College sports also have a strong pull, especially in the Twin Cities, where Big Ten football and basketball are a major focus.
Since traditional betting is still blocked, daily fantasy sports (DFS) and social casinos have become popular stand-ins. These platforms give Minnesotans a way to play for prizes and stay engaged with their favorite teams until a regulated market finally opens.

Taxes on Online Winnings
As bettors, it’s crucial to understand our tax obligations. Whether you’re winning big on a traditional payout or cryptocurrencies, both federal and Minnesota state taxes apply. The IRS mandates that all gambling winnings, including those from cryptocurrencies, must be reported as taxable income. Minnesota sports betting might not be legal yet, but the tax implications remain if you play elsewhere.
Here’s how you can accurately report your gambling winnings on your tax returns:

- Gather documents: Collect all relevant documents such as win/loss statements from the sportsbook.
- Fill out IRS Form W-2G: This is needed for any gambling win of $600 or more.
- Report offshore gambling: Use your bank statements and other evidence to declare winnings from offshore sportsbooks.
- File state taxes: Ensure you’re compliant with Minnesota state tax requirements even if your bets are placed offshore.
